muricide

English dictionary entry

Meanings

noun
  1. Mouse-killing (especially in rats).
  2. Someone or something that kills mice, rats, or voles.

Word forms

muricide muricides

Etymology

Borrowed from Latin mūricīdus (literally “mouse-killer”). By surface analysis, Latin mūs (“mouse”) + -icide (“killing; killer”).
